First AgustaWestland AW189 full-flight simulator set to enter service in 2013 with Rotorsim

logo_rotorsimRotorsim, a consortium owned equally by CAE and AgustaWestland, a Finmeccanica company, announced at the Helicopter Association International (HAI) Heli-Expo conference that it will operate the world’s first AgustaWestland AW189 full-flight simulator (FFS). The CAE 3000 Series simulator will be installed at AgustaWestland’s “A. Marchetti” Training Academy in Sesto Calende, Italy and will be available for training from the third quarter 2013.

AgustaWestland & Priority 1 Air Rescue Sign Collaboration Agreement For The Delivery Of Helicopter Rear Crew Training Courses

ag_8AgustaWestland, a Finmeccanica company, is pleased to announce it has signed a Collaboration Agreement with Priority 1 Air Rescue for the delivery of helicopter rear crew training courses to AgustaWestland customers. The agreement was signed today at Heli Expo 2012 in Dallas by John Ponsonby, Senior VP Training, AgustaWestland and Brad Matheson, President of Priority 1 Air Rescue.

AgustaWestland Commences Major Expansion Programme Of Its Sesto Calende Training Academy

ag_3AgustaWestland, a Finmeccanica company, has commenced construction work on a new simulator hall at its “A. Marchetti” Training Academy located in Sesto Calende, Italy. The new simulator hall will be able to house up to nine full-flight simulators (FFSs) and six flight training devices (FTDs).

HATSOFF announces new Chief Executive Officer

hatsoffThe Helicopter Academy to Train by Simulation of Flying (HATSOFF), the joint venture owned equally by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L) and CAE, today announced the appointment of Major General (Retd.) Ajit Hari Gadre as Chief Executive Officer of HATSOFF.

CAE to deploy three new helicopter simulator training programs in Norway and Brazil

logo_caeCAE today announced on the eve of the Helicopter Association International (HAI) Heli-Expo conference that it will deploy three new simulation-based training programs for helicopter pilots and maintenance engineers.
